Descripción editorial

A short dark comedy from Spain, set during the Holy Week Festival in present-day Seville where Winston, a naive middle-aged transvestite, encounters a petty thief nicknamed 'sour face'.

Antonio Onetti's play Bleeding Heart was first performed in this English translation by Oscar Ceballos and Mary Peate at the Royal Court Theatre, London, in 1997.
